The HDMI vertical connector is specifically designed to provide a clean and efficient way to connect devices without the clutter usually associated with horizontal connectors. Its main function is to allow HDMI cables to plug in vertically, saving space and making it easier to access ports. This is particularly useful in tight spaces, such as behind television units or computer desks, where horizontal connections can lead to tangled wires and accessibility issues.
In addition to space-saving benefits, these connectors also facilitate better airflow around devices. This can be crucial for preventing overheating, thereby prolonging the lifespan of your electronics. Furthermore, the vertical design minimizes the chance of cable damage, as the cables sit flush against the device rather than being pulled or bent unnaturally.
However, like any product, HDMI vertical connectors have their pros and cons. On the plus side, their space efficiency and neat appearance can transform a chaotic setup into a streamlined one. They can accommodate multiple devices without requiring extensive horizontal space, making them ideal for small apartments or compact workstations. Many users have found that fewer protruding cables mean less dust accumulation and easier cleaning.
On the downside, compatibility is something to consider. Not all HDMI vertical connectors support the latest HDMI standards, which may result in limitations regarding video quality or data transfer speeds. Users should ensure that the connector they choose supports their intended resolution, such as 4K or even 8K, especially if they are using high-end devices. It's also worth noting that some models may be priced higher than standard horizontal connectors, which can deter budget-conscious buyers.
